Rainbow, a rainbow is a sign of showry weather.
Clouds. If the clouds are black or rolling, it is a sign of rain.
Wind If the wind is from Dunnamaggin it is a sign of rain.
Nearness of hills. If the hills are near it is a sign of rain.
